Output 11debda43057587055366f4a0c10898ec9667472c01b83d5996fe141f9950707:92

value
35276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18e5a4e692cdfd05a7ebe8e81a2a6694b3beb5ef92fb850fcf7667363f9bcdfe
address
bc1prrj6fe5jeh7stfltar5p52nxjjemad00jtac2r70wennv0umehlqn90hkn
transaction
11debda43057587055366f4a0c10898ec9667472c01b83d5996fe141f9950707
spent
true